InstallShield Professional Logging Method

Note •
The InstallShield Professional Logging Method is supported for InstallShield Editor and DevStudio 9.x
InstallScript installations.
Using the InstallShield Professional Logging Method, Repackager can read logged output of InstallShield
Editor and DevStudio 9.x InstallScript installations. This enables Repackager to capture additional information from
those installations that would not be captured by the Installation Monitoring or Snapshot methods: path
variables and the feature tree.
Path Variables
When using the InstallShield Professional Logging Method, path variables are captured and converted into
properties (using text substitution rather than hard-coded path names).
For example, if you were using a standard repackaging method, the path name of the application's executable file
would be captured as follows:
C:\Program Files\CompanyName\ApplicationName\ProgramName.exe
When using the InstallShield Professional Logging Method, the executable path name would be captured using a
path variable instead of a hard-coded path name:
[INSTALLDIR]\ProgramName.exe
Feature Tree
The InstallShield Professional Logging Method is able to group files, shortcuts and registry entries into features
corresponding to InstallShield Professional components. Any items (files, folders, shortcuts, or registry entries) that
are attached to a component directly or indirectly (through File Groups), are attached to corresponding features.
If you do not use the InstallShield Professional Logging Method to repackage an InstallShield Editor or DevStudio
9.x InstallScript installation, all files, shortcuts and registry entries would be installed together as one feature.
Selecting the InstallShield Professional Logging Method
You access the InstallShield Professional Logging Method through the Repackaging Wizard, but InstallShield
Professional Logging Method is not offered as a choice on the Method Selection Panel of the Repackaging
Wizard. Only Installation Monitoring and Snapshot are listed:
